Размер кодовых слов в двоичном алфавите
Информатика

Каков минимально возможный размер кодовых слов, определенных следующим образом: «Чтобы перекодировать сообщение

Каков минимально возможный размер кодовых слов, определенных следующим образом: «Чтобы перекодировать сообщение в двоичный алфавит, длину кодовых слов L необходимо выбирать следующим образом, где N - мощность исходного алфавита сообщения»?
Верные ответы (2):
  • Ящерка
    Ящерка
    64
    Показать ответ
    Предмет вопроса: Размер кодовых слов в двоичном алфавите

    Пояснение:
    Для перекодировки сообщения в двоичный алфавит необходимо использовать кодовые слова определенного размера. Размер кодовых слов L выбирается согласно следующему правилу: L ≥ log₂(N), где N - мощность исходного алфавита сообщения.

    Объяснение этого правила заключается в том, что для кодирования всех символов исходного алфавита нужно иметь достаточно битовой емкости. В двоичном алфавите каждый символ может быть представлен как сочетание 0 и 1. Чтобы представить N символов, необходимо иметь достаточное количество битов. Мощность исходного алфавита сообщения N определяет количество символов, которые могут быть закодированы.

    Доп. материал:
    Предположим, у нас есть исходный алфавит сообщения, состоящий из 8 символов. Чтобы перекодировать это сообщение в двоичный алфавит, необходимо выбрать минимально возможный размер кодовых слов.

    L ≥ log₂(8)
    L ≥ 3

    Таким образом, минимально возможный размер кодовых слов составляет 3 бита.

    Совет:
    Чтобы лучше понять эту концепцию, можно представить, что каждый символ исходного алфавита сообщения имеет свой уникальный двоичный код. Чем больше символов в исходном алфавите, тем больше битов необходимо для их кодирования. Поэтому важно помнить, что размер кодовых слов должен быть достаточным для кодирования всех символов.

    Дополнительное задание:
    В исходном алфавите сообщения есть 5 символов. Какой будет минимально возможный размер кодовых слов в двоичном алфавите?
  • Светлана
    Светлана
    44
    Показать ответ
    Суть вопроса: Размер кодовых слов в двоичном алфавите

    Пояснение: Для определения минимально возможного размера кодовых слов в двоичном алфавите, используется формула Шеннона для кодирования. Формула Шеннона гласит, что минимальная длина кодового слова L определяется по формуле L = ceil(log2(N)), где N - мощность исходного алфавита сообщения.

    Эта формула основана на предположении, что мы используем двоичную систему счисления, где каждый символ представлен двоичным кодом. Формула Шеннона позволяет определить минимальное количество бит, необходимых для кодирования каждого символа исходного алфавита сообщения.

    Например, если исходный алфавит состоит из 8 символов, то мощность исходного алфавита N = 8. Подставив значения в формулу Шеннона, получим L = ceil(log2(8)) = ceil(3) = 3. Таким образом, минимально возможный размер кодовых слов для данного алфавита составит 3 бита.

    Совет: Для лучшего понимания этой темы рекомендуется изучить основы двоичной системы счисления и понятие логарифма.

    Практика: Определите минимально возможный размер кодовых слов для алфавита с мощностью N = 16.
Написать свой ответ: